“…PDT and SDT are both treatments transforming the molecular oxygen into cytotoxic 1 O 2 in tumor area towards the ablation of tumor cells, in which the photosensitizers or sonosensitizers react with the endogenous O 2 in the presence of appropriate light illumination or ultrasound treatment, respectively [ 2 , 143 ]. However, limited to the hypoxia condition in the tumor area, PDT or SDT could be combined with other treatment strategies for superior anticancer efficacy than a single treatment [ 144 ]. A synergistic strategy of combining PTT and SDT was proposed by integrating iridium complexes into black-titanium nanoparticles camouflaged with cancer cell membranes.…”
